Dieses offizielle Versionsupdate fügt hauptsächlich das Videokontomodul hinzu, das mit den meisten Schnittstellen verbunden wurde; das Unternehmens-WeChat-Modul behebt hauptsächlich einige Probleme, fügt einige praktische Schnittstellen hinzu und passt einige Schnittstellen gemäß den neuesten offiziellen Dokumenten an; Miniprogramm Das Modul fügt hauptsächlich hinzu Verwandte Schnittstellen wie OpenApi-Verwaltung, Versandinformationsverwaltung, Medien-Asset-Management für kurze Dramen, virtuelle Zahlung für Miniprogramme, Rückgabekomponenten usw. und optimiert einige Codes. Das offizielle Kontomodul fügt hauptsächlich eine Schnittstelle hinzu, um Anmeldeinformationen für stabile Versionsschnittstellen zu erhalten Das WeChat-Zahlungsmodul ergänzt und verbessert hauptsächlich einige Schnittstellen und fügt Unterstützung für einige Felder hinzu; andere Module optimieren einige Schnittstellen, beheben einige Probleme und fügen relevante Parameter hinzu. Das spezifische Update-Protokoll lautet wie folgt:
Unternehmens-WeChat
- #2993 Die Parameter der Schnittstelle zur Aktualisierung sensibler Wörter wurden gemäß den neuesten offiziellen Dokumenten angepasst
- #3002 Behebung des Problems des Deduplizierungsfehlers beim Rückruf neuer externer Kontakte
- #3016 Fügen Sie eine Schnittstelle zum Abrufen von Kundendatenstatistiken und detaillierten Daten von Rezeptionisten hinzu und beheben Sie das Problem mit dem Rückgabewert der Schnittstelle zum Abrufen von Unternehmenszusammenfassungsdaten
- #3037 Behebung des Problems fehlender Felder für Entitäten mit unterschiedlichen Rückrufen zur Genehmigung durch Dritte
- #3047 Rufen Sie den Rückgabewert der Mitarbeiter-Punch-In-Regelschnittstelle ab und fügen Sie Planungsinformationen hinzu
- #3055 Fügen Sie dem Rückgabewert der Schnittstelle mehrere Felder hinzu, um auf vertrauliche Benutzerinformationen zuzugreifen
- #3059 Fügen Sie der Kundendetailseite Felder für Videonummern hinzu
- #3064 Schnittstelle zum Kundenakquise-Assistenten hinzugefügt
- #3079 Fügen Sie Schnittstellen hinzu, um Mitglieder an Massennachrichten zu erinnern und Massennachrichten im Unternehmen zu stoppen
- #3145 Fügen Sie beim Erstellen einer Unternehmensgruppen-Messaging-Schnittstelle zwei neue Parameter hinzu, chat_id_list undallow_select.
- #3149 Starter hinzufügen, um die Konfiguration mehrerer WeChat-Unternehmenskonten zu unterstützen
- #3156 Optimieren Sie die Initialisierungslogik, wenn die Parameter der Enterprise-WeChat-Anwendung nicht konfiguriert sind
- #3174 Fügen Sie das Attribut „Genehmigungsdokumenttyp“ zum Filtertyp in der Schnittstellenanforderung hinzu, um Genehmigungsdokumentnummern in Stapeln zu erhalten
- #3178 Uint64-bezogene Felddefinition in der Deserialisierungsschnittstelle des Sitzungsarchivs korrigiert, Typ BigInteger verwenden
- #3179 Fügen Sie eine Methode zum Senden von Sprachnachrichten in der Schnittstelle zum Senden von Gruppenroboter-Nachrichten hinzu
- #3184 Es wurde eine Schnittstelle für Komponenten von Drittanbietern hinzugefügt, um die Nutzungsdetails von Kundenakquise-Links abzufragen
- #3185 Die Schnittstelle zum Abrufen von Genehmigungsantragsdetails bietet Unterstützung für Positionskontrollen und Formelkontrollen.
- #3186 Fügen Sie eine Schnittstelle hinzu, um die Anmeldeidentität des Benutzers und sekundäre Verifizierungsinformationen des Benutzers zu erhalten
- #3187 Die Schnittstellenmethode zum stapelweisen Abrufen von Genehmigungsauftragsnummern bietet Unterstützung für neue Paging-Felder.
- #3190 Fügen Sie das Feld „member_version“ zur Antwortklasse der Schnittstelle zum Abrufen von Kundengruppendetails hinzu und entfernen Sie das Feld „Abgelaufener Status“.
- Korrigieren Sie den Drittanbieter, um die neueste Schnittstellenadresse zu erhalten, z. B. die Zugriffsbenutzeridentität.
Keine Öffentlichkeit
- #3006 Vorlage für die Schnittstelle zum Senden von Nachrichten fügt das Feld „client_msg_id“ hinzu
- #3078 Die Schnittstelle für Vorlagennachrichten zum Abrufen der Vorlagen-ID fügt Parameter für die Auswahl von Schlüsselwörtern von Kategorievorlagen hinzu.
- #3084 Fügen Sie eine Schnittstelle hinzu, um die Anmeldeinformationen der Schnittstelle für die stabile Version zu erhalten
- #3142 Die Zustellungsschnittstelle für Abonnementbenachrichtigungen gibt die Nachrichten-ID zurück
- #3170 Korrigieren Sie die Parameterposition von is_snapshotuser (unabhängig davon, ob es sich um ein virtuelles Konto im Snapshot-Seitenmodus handelt) und geben Sie ihn zurück, wenn Sie die getAccessToken-Schnittstelle anfordern
- #3196 Behebung des Problems, dass die Schnittstelle „materialImageOrVoiceDownload“ das AccessToken nicht normal aktualisieren kann
Applets
- #2998 Fügen Sie eine Schnittstelle hinzu, um die Anmeldeinformationen für die Schnittstelle der stabilen Version zu erhalten, und aktivieren Sie die Verwendung der Schnittstelle der stabilen Version, indem Sie die Methode WxMaConfig#useStableAccessToken festlegen.
- #3024 Senden Sie die Anforderungsklasse der Gerätenachrichtenschnittstelle, um das Feld für die Gerätemodell-ID hinzuzufügen
- #3077 Schnittstellenunterstützung für die OpenApi-Verwaltung hinzugefügt
- #3083 Schnittstellen zur Versandinformationsverwaltung hinzugefügt
- #3115 Unterstützung für Schnittstellen zum Medien-Asset-Management für kurze Dramen hinzugefügt
- #3122 Zugehörige Schnittstellen für virtuelles Bezahlen im Miniprogramm hinzufügen
- #3124 Implementieren Sie die Schnittstelle zum Abfragen von URL-Links
- #3194 Optimieren Sie einige Feldinformationen der Antwortklasse einiger openApi-Schnittstellen (getApiQuota und getRidInfo).
- Die Abfrageschnittstelle für den Codeüberprüfungsstatus gibt drei zusätzliche Parameter zurück.
- Fügen Sie Schnittstellen zu Rückgabekomponenten hinzu und fügen Sie fehlende Rückgabewerte zur Schnittstelle für das Binden/Entbinden von Logistikkonten hinzu.
- Fügen Sie die Applet-Schema-Schnittstelle hinzu, um NFC zu erhalten
WeChat-Bezahlung
- #3009 Bei der Händlerübertragung zur Änderungsschnittstelle wird das Feld „Transferszenen-ID“ hinzugefügt
- #3023 Fügen Sie eine Schnittstelle hinzu, um den Echtzeit-Saldo von Sekundärhändlern basierend auf dem Kontotyp abzufragen, und beheben Sie die Probleme im Zusammenhang mit der Schnittstelle für Sammelübertragungsaufträge.
- #3045 Korrigieren Sie die Verschlüsselungsfunktion des Felds „Name“ in der Empfängerliste des Unterkontos
- #3056 Optimieren Sie die Analyse der Zahlungs-/Rückerstattungsergebnisse und fügen Sie Bestell-/Rückerstattungsunterstützung für Dienstanbieter der V3-Version hinzu
- #3063 Fügen Sie eine Schnittstelle zum Abschluss von Aufträgen im Dienstleistermodus hinzu
- #3066 Schnittstellenunterstützung für Bestellabfrage im Service-Provider-Modus V3 hinzugefügt
- #3070 Optimieren Sie die Bestelloberfläche im Dienstleistermodus und entfernen Sie einige doppelte Codes
- #3089 Fügen Sie eine neue Rückgabeklasse für die Schnittstelle „Gutscheindetails“ und ein Feld für die Händlerdokumentnummer hinzu
- #3102 Korrigieren Sie den Parameternamen in der Anforderung für die Fondsrechnungsschnittstelle
- #3103 v3 fügt der Ergebnisklasse der Händlerübertragungsschnittstelle ein Batch-Statusfeld hinzu
- #3106 Feldtypen wie Rückerstattungsbetrag in der Benachrichtigung über das Rückerstattungsergebnis korrigiert
- #3111 Feld „Sub-Merchant-Anwendungs-ID“ zur Benutzeroberfläche für die Kontofreigabe hinzugefügt
- #3128 Bietet die Möglichkeit, httpclientbuilder zu erweitern
- #3136 Füllen Sie die Felder einiger Schnittstellen gemäß den neuesten offiziellen Dokumenten aus
- #3138 Fügen Sie eine Schnittstelle zum Abfragen des Antragsstatus für die Änderung des Abrechnungskontos hinzu
- #3154 Behebung einer abnormalen Ausnahme bei der täglichen Download- und Entnahme-Antwort bei der Dateischnittstelle
- #3162 Zugriff auf verwandte Schnittstellenfunktionen des WeChat-Zahlungsuntervertragsplans des Dienstanbieters
- #3169 Schnittstellen zur Bestätigung der Bereitschaft des Händlers zur Kontoeröffnung hinzugefügt
- #3171 Einige Feldtypen des WeChat-Zahlungsuntervertragsplans ändern
- Das Feld „Finanzinstitutslizenzbild“ in den Anforderungsparametern der sekundären Händlerimportanwendungsschnittstelle wird in den richtigen Typ geändert.
- Optimieren Sie die Benachrichtigung über Wiederverwendungsaufträge SignatureHeader
- Der Rückgabeklasse der Schnittstelle zum Auftauen verbleibender Mittel des Buchhaltungsmoduls werden mehrere Felder hinzugefügt
- Anweisungen zur V3-Version des WeChat-Zahlungsdienstleisters hinzugefügt
- V3-Schnittstelle für Dienstanbieter hinzugefügt, um einzelne Rückerstattungen abzufragen
- Analysemethode zum Aufteilen von Benachrichtigungen im Dienstanbietermodus hinzugefügt
- V3-Unterkonto-Abfrageschnittstelle hinzugefügt und die Unterkonto-Abfrageergebnisschnittstelle geändert, um das Feld „detail_id“ für die Bestellnummer des Unterkontos hinzuzufügen
- Der Zahlungsbenachrichtigungsoberfläche des Dienstanbieters wurden mehrere Felder hinzugefügt.
- Die Ergebnisklasse der Rückerstattungsabfrageschnittstelle fügt Felder wie den gesamten Rückerstattungsbetrag, den gesamten Rückerstattungsbetrag des Gutscheins und den Rückerstattungsbetrag des Benutzers hinzu.
- Rekonstruieren Sie die mit dem Ledger verbundenen Schnittstellen, benennen Sie die Schnittstellenmethoden und Anforderungsentitäten um und führen Sie die Implementierungsklassen Ledger v2 und v3 zusammen, um die gleichzeitige Verwendung zu erleichtern.
- Optimieren Sie das Feld „Zahler“ in der Klasse „WxPayPartnerOrderQueryV3Result“.
- Optimieren Sie den WeChat-Code für die Behandlung von Zahlungsausnahmen, damit er mit den verwirrenden und perversen Gewohnheiten bei der Benennung offizieller WeChat-Felder kompatibel ist
Videonummer
- #2991 Fügen Sie das Videokontomodul hinzu, um die meisten Videokonto-bezogenen Schnittstellen zu implementieren
- #3167 Die Sharer-Bestellschnittstelle für Video-Konto-Stores fügt mehrere Rückgabeparameter hinzu und korrigiert den Parametertyp „openid“.
- Schnittstelle zum Zustimmen und Ablehnen einer Änderung der Adresse des Videothekens hinzugefügt! 114
- Die Benutzeroberfläche des Videokonto-Shops zum Abrufen von Bestelldetails fügt einige Felder hinzu! 113
offene Plattform
- #3040 Der Miniprogramm-Verwaltungsteil der Schnittstelle gibt die Ergebnisklasse zum Hinzufügen von Parametern zurück und fügt außerdem eine neue Schnittstelle hinzu (fragen Sie den sichtbaren Status des Online-Codes des Miniprogramms ab und erhalten Sie die Überprüfungsdatei für den Geschäftsdomänennamen des Miniprogramms).
- #3116 Die Schnittstelle zur gemeinsamen Nutzung der Cloud-Entwicklungs-/Cloud-Hosting-Umgebung fügt Quellparameter der Anforderungsumgebung hinzu
- #3182 Stellen Sie die Schnittstellenmethode für den Server-Domänennamen ein, um Parameter für den zulässigen TCP-Domänennamen und den zulässigen UDP-Domänennamen hinzuzufügen
- #3189 Test-Applet-Schnellauthentifizierungsschnittstelle hinzufügen
- #3198 Ändern Sie den Autorisierungslink der H5-Version in den Link der neuen Version
- #3083 Schnittstellen wie Einkaufsbestellverwaltung für Drittplattformen hinzufügen
- Feldtypfehler in der Schnellauthentifizierung des Test-Applets behoben
Andere öffentliche Themen
- #2999 Behebung des Problems des Fehlers beim asynchronen Nachrichtenrouting
- #3005 Stellt eine Verbrauchsschnittstelle zum Aktualisieren von access_token bereit
- Das Problem wurde behoben, bei dem sowohl AppId als auch Appid vorhanden waren, was dazu führte, dass Lombok Codeausnahmen generierte
- Behebung des Problems, dass das Handle nicht freigegeben werden kann, wenn öffentliche und private Schlüsseldateien mit java.nio.file.Files geöffnet werden
- Kompatibel mit der in SpringBoot3 verwendeten Jedis4-Version
- Stellen Sie Methoden bereit, um Klassen von Drittanbietern die Verwendung von XStreamTransformer für die Serialisierung zu erleichtern, und unterstützen Sie XStream 1.4.18 und höher, um die Sicherheitsberechtigungen zu erhöhen